A company has two offices - one in Portlee and one in Queentown.
The ratio of the number of employees at Portlee to the number at Queentown is 3:4
20% of the employees at Portlee are part-time.
25% of the employees at Queentown are part-time.
Altogether the company has 32 part-time employees.
Work out the total number of employees the company has.
The company has the total number of employees as 140.
What is the ratio?It is described as the comparison of two quantities to determine how many times one obtains the other. The proportion can be expressed as a fraction or as a sign: between two integers.
We are given that company has two offices - one in Portlee and one in Queentown.
The ratio of the number of employees at Portlee to the number at Queentown is given as;
3:4
Now we know that 20% of the employees at Portlee are part-time.
25% of the employees at Queentown are part-time.
Therefore, 3x of 20% are part- time
4x of 25%
Then we have 32 part-time employees.
0.6x + 1x = 32
1.6x = 32
x = 32/1.6
x = 20
Hence, the total number of employees the company has
3x + 4x = 7x
7(20) = 140

iq scores have a mean of 100 and standard deviation of 16. sat scores have a mean of 1000 with a standard deviation of 100. which is probably less likely, randomly meeting someone whose IQ is under 80 or someone who obtained a SAT score of over 1150
It is less likely to randomly meet someone who obtained a SAT score of over 1150.
What is Z score?Z score or standard score is defined as the number of standard deviations by which the observed value is above or below the mean value.
The formula for calculating z score is,
z = (x - μ) / σ
where x is the observed value, μ is the population mean and σ is the population standard deviation.
For IQ scores,
z = (80 - 100) / 16 = -1.25
For SAT scores,
z = (1150 - 1000) / 100 = 150/100 = 1.5
z score is closer to 0 for IQ scores and far to 0 for SAT scores.
Hence it is less likely to meet someone who obtained a SAT score of over 1150.

how many degrees does the minute hand of a clock turn in 45 minutes
The clock minutes rotate 270 degrees in 45 minutes.
How to calculate the angular size of a clock's handsWhile rotating, the clock's hands are seen to move at a speed of six degrees per minute.
The number of degrees for a clock minute is solved by
60 minutes = 360 degrees
1 minute = ?
cross multiplying
60 * ? = 360
? = 360 / 60
? = 6
hence 1 minute is 6 degrees
The formula to use to get the calculation is multiplying the number of minutes by 6
Number of degrees in 45 minutes = 45 * 6
Number of degrees in 45 minutes = 270 degrees
